Andean Caenolestid vs Misiones Akodont
Caenolestes condorensis compared with Brucepattersonius misionensis
Key Differences
- Andean Caenolestid is Vulnerable while Misiones Akodont is Data Deficient.
Taxonomic Classification
| Rank | Andean Caenolestid | Misiones Akodont |
|---|---|---|
| Kingdom same | Animalia (животные) | Animalia (животные) |
| Phylum same | Chordata (хордовые) | Chordata (хордовые) |
| Class same | Mammalia (млекопитающие) | Mammalia (млекопитающие) |
| Order | Paucituberculata (Paucituberculata) | Rodentia (грызуны) |
| Family | Caenolestidae | Cricetidae |
| Genus | Caenolestes | Brucepattersonius |
| Species | Caenolestes condorensis | Brucepattersonius misionensis |
Evolutionary Relationship
Andean Caenolestid and Misiones Akodont share a common ancestor at the Class level: Mammalia. (млекопитающие)
